When aluminum oxide reacts with hydrogen fluoride then it forms Aluminum fluoride and water .

The reaction are as follows::

Al2O3 + 6HF ==> 2AIF3 + 3H2O

Aluminum oxide + Hydrogen fluoride => Aluminum fluoride + water
